In Australia, a full time Application Developer generally earns $2,350 per week ($122,200 annual salary) before tax. This is a median figure for full-time employees and should be considered a guide only. As you gain more experience you can expect a potentially higher salary than people who are new to the industry.

The number of people working in this industry has grown strongly over the last five years. There are currently 30,600 people employed in this sector in Australia and many of them specialise as an Application Developer. Application Developers may find work across all regions of Australia, particularly larger towns and cities.

Source: Australian Government Labour Market Insights

If a career as an Application Developer interests you, a Bachelor of Computer Science could be an ideal qualification. This course will give you the skills to develop software, apps and algorithms in areas such as ecommerce, networking, security, database systems, artificial intelligence, gaming and mobile technologies. A Bachelor of Information Technology may also be suitable.
